
Far from a classic as both sides will feel they weren't at their best but it mattered not from those of a blue persuasion as we sealed a league double against our Devon rivals. By half time the points were effectively wrapped and under the tree as we raced into a 7-31 lead. Sidmouth provided a much improved threat in the second forty and got their own bonus point via four tries but they never threatened more as we added our ribbons and bows. Nine tries in total for our boys for the second week running with seven different scorers adding to their collections. Perhaps the most impressive aspect of our game was a superb scrum and impressive set piece that competed brilliantly against a big Sidmouth forward pack.
Results elsewhere mean we cut the gap at the top to just a point as Devonport won without a bonus - although it was almost even better as the in-form and much improved St Austell were minutes from winning. Further down Brixham's win over Lydney means the gap to fourth and a spot out of the playoffs is now up to nineteen points although our rivals there have a game in hand.
A much deserved rest and a whole lot of turkey now await with our next league match for the 1st XV on the 10th Jan at home to Royal Wootton Bassett.
